History of the Masters Tournament

The Masters Tournament was first held in 1934 and has been played every year since, except for a few years during World War II.

The tournament was founded by Bobby Jones, a legendary golfer, and Clifford Roberts, a New York investment banker.

The tournament was initially called the Augusta National Invitation Tournament and was only open to a select group of golfers.

Over the years, the tournament has grown in popularity and prestige, and today it is one of the most-watched golf events in the world.

The tournament has produced many memorable moments, including Jack Nicklaus’ historic win in 1986, Tiger Woods’ record-breaking win in 1997, and Phil Mickelson’s emotional win in 2010.

The Venue: Augusta National Golf Club

The Masters Tournament is held at the Augusta National Golf Club, a private golf club in Augusta, Georgia.

The course was designed by golf legend Bobby Jones and opened in 1933. The course has undergone several renovations over the years, but it still retains its original charm and character.

The Augusta National Golf Club is known for its beautiful, scenic setting, with its lush fairways and towering trees.

The course is challenging, with its strategically placed bunkers and water hazards, and it requires precision and skill to navigate.

The Augusta National Golf Club is also known for its strict rules and regulations.

The club has a strict dress code, and patrons are not allowed to bring in mobile phones or other electronic devices.

The club is also known for its famous pimento cheese sandwiches, which are a must-try for any golf fan attending the tournament.

Understanding Golf Terminology

Understanding golf terminology can enhance your enjoyment of the Masters. Some common terms to know include:

  • Birdie: A score of one stroke under par on a hole.
  • Bogey: A score of one stroke over par on a hole.
  • Par: The number of strokes a skilled golfer should take to complete a hole.
  • Rough: The long grass surrounding the fairway and green.
  • Hazard: Any obstacle on the course that makes it difficult to play a shot, such as a bunker or water hazard.

Knowing these terms can help you understand the commentators and follow the action more easily.
